Section 1: The Rise of Artificial Intelligence and Machine Learning

The integration of Artificial Intelligence (AI) and Machine Learning (ML) into the Executive Development Programme in Modeling and Analysis of Complex Systems has been a game-changer. These technologies enable executives to analyze vast amounts of data, identify patterns, and predict outcomes with unprecedented accuracy. By leveraging AI and ML, leaders can develop more sophisticated models of complex systems, allowing them to simulate different scenarios, test hypotheses, and make more informed decisions. For instance, a company like IBM has successfully implemented AI-powered modeling to optimize its supply chain, resulting in significant cost savings and improved efficiency. As AI and ML continue to evolve, we can expect to see even more innovative applications in this field, such as the use of natural language processing to analyze complex systems.

Section 3: The Role of Data Analytics and Visualization

The sheer volume and complexity of data generated by complex systems can be overwhelming, making it challenging for executives to extract insights and make informed decisions. The Executive Development Programme has responded to this challenge by incorporating advanced data analytics and visualization techniques. These tools enable leaders to distill complex data into actionable insights, identify trends and patterns, and communicate their findings effectively to stakeholders. For instance, a company like Tableau has developed data visualization software that allows executives to create interactive and dynamic dashboards, enabling them to explore complex data in a more intuitive and engaging way. As data analytics and visualization continue to evolve, we can expect to see even more innovative applications in this field, such as the use of virtual and augmented reality to visualize complex systems.
